The garage occupancy feed for the Brindlewood campus arrives over a message queue every thirty seconds, one record per level, published by the Stallgrid edge boxes. Counts can briefly go negative when a sensor double-fires on exit; the ingest job clamps these to zero and flags the interval. If the feed stalls for more than five minutes, the dashboard falls back to the last known snapshot. Sensor mappings, queue names, and the replay procedure are documented on the internal page below.

runbook for tahog-kadug: https://gitlab.qirvanworks.corp/projects/pages/view/b139298aed28

// AUTOCOMPLETE_INDEX_REFRESH_MS controls rebuild cadence for the
// Quillfox suggestion index. Raising it past 5 min made typeahead
// stale; lowering it below 60s thrashed the store and slowed
// queries to ~900ms p95. Current value is the measured sweet spot.
// Do not change without rerunning the latency bench. The baseline
// run is identified by the build token below.

pipeline stamp: htk3_69f

Q: Where did the mail room go? A: Good question — it moved last month from Level 1 to the annex behind the Birchgate Building cafeteria. Contractors expecting parts deliveries should head through the courtyard, past the bike racks, and follow the yellow signage. The annex door stays locked during lunch, so you'll need to let yourself in with the keypad using the code below.

staff pass of kawep-hahap = bdg-IEUUF-6

Subject: Key rotation for InvoiceForge renderer

Welcome, new folks. Every quarter we rotate the credential the Pellworth PDF invoice renderer uses to call our internal asset service, Vaultline. The old key stops working Friday at noon. Update your local .env and the staging config before then, and verify a test invoice renders with the new embedded fonts. For convenience, the freshly issued key is included here.

app token of bagef-bageg = kto11_vuwA0uhrEMg

Subject: Key rotation for the Mapforge tile cache

Hey folks,

Heads up — the old credentials for the Mapforge tile-rendering cache layer expire Friday. The cache sits between the renderer and Pebbleworks storage, so if the key lapses, every tile request falls through to cold renders and latency triples. I've already swapped staging; prod flips Thursday night. Update your local env files before then so your dev proxies keep working. The new key is below.

service key, yadug-bajog: zpat3_pou